Hi Wrstler,

Pls Reffer This Helpful For U....

If U Can't Able To Open this File Means,

Script Code:

Table:

CrossTable(Topic, Values)

LOAD [Topic Content ID],

     [Topic: Calvin Klein],

     [Topic: Diesel],

     [Topic: Killer Jeans],

     [Topic: Lee Cooper Jeans],

     [Topic: Lee Jeans],

     [Topic: Levis],

     [Topic: Pepe Jeans London],

     [Topic: Spykar],

     [Topic: Wrangler Jeans]

FROM

[1223.xlsx]

(ooxml, embedded labels, table is Topic);

Table2:

LOAD *,

subfield(Topic,':',2) as JEANS_Name

Resident Table;

DROP Table Table;
